Dr. Sue Cornbluth: When Your Adult Child Goes No Contact and What to Do Next
What if the biggest obstacle to reconnecting with your estranged child isn't them, it's the way you've been trying to reach them?In this episode of The Soulful Catalyst, I'm joined by Dr. Sue Cornbluth, a certified parenting expert, author, coach, and thought leader with international recognition. Dr. Sue specialises in high-conflict divorce, estrangement, and parental and grandparent alienation, and has an extensive media career as a psychological analyst for Court TV.Dr. Sue's work sits right at one of the most painful places a parent can find themselves: loving a child deeply and not being in their life. She works with parents to become the solution to their own family conflict, not by telling their child what to do, but by fundamentally shifting how they show up. As she says, you cannot change another person, but you can absolutely change how you react to them. That is where your power is.What struck me most in this conversation is how clearly she names the thing that keeps parents stuck. Many arrive convinced they've done nothing wrong. And Dr. Sue has to gently, expertly take them back through the pattern of behaviours their child experienced. Because it's rarely one incident. It's repetition over time. And the path forward isn't argument or explanation. Harriet Taylor: The Part of Menopause Support Nobody's Talking About
What if menopause didn't have to be something you endure, but something you could actually move through with support, clarity, and a sense of your own power?In this episode of The Soulful Catalyst, I'm joined by Harriet Taylor, Female Empowerment Facilitator and Menopause Wellness Consultant, on a mission to help women feel supported, heard, and genuinely empowered through the menopause transition. Drawing on both lived experience and professional training, Harriet brings a holistic approach that goes well beyond the clinical.Harriet came to this work the way so many of us do. Through her own experience. After a hysterectomy in 2023, she was suddenly facing a transition she hadn't planned for, and she noticed something: the support available to women was fragmented, clinical, and rarely addressed the whole person. She trained as a Reiki practitioner, brought her years of counselling experience alongside it, and began doing something she calls translation. Helping women articulate what they're going through clearly enough that their GPs, employers, and families can finally understand it too 😊.What I loved most about this conversation is how grounded and honest Harriet is. She isn't here to tell you menopause is wonderful. She is here to tell you it doesn't have to stop you in your tracks. Karen Wagnon: When You Know Your Child Is Wired Differently Than You
What if the reason you're struggling with your child has nothing to do with how much you love them, and everything to do with how differently you're each wired?In this episode of The Soulful Catalyst, I'm joined by Karen Wagnon, Human Behaviour Specialist, Educator, and Founder of Teaching Our Youth and The Parenting Blueprint. With over 22 years of experience working with parents and educators, Karen helps families understand the personality behind behaviour, so that guidance actually lands, relationships grow stronger, and the daily grind of parenting becomes something a whole lot more like connection.Karen's entry point into this work was deeply personal. She was highly successful in her career, but when she became a mum, she hit a wall. Her eldest son Kyle was strong-willed, and no matter how hard she pushed, nothing was working. It wasn't until she encountered personality-based frameworks in a corporate setting that something clicked: her child wasn't defying her to be difficult. He was simply wired differently. And she was trying to bend him into her shape, instead of learning to speak his language .What she realised, and what she's now spent decades teaching, is that the tools most of us reach for when parenting gets hard, raising our voice, repeating ourselves, just trying harder, don't work because they were never designed for that child's specific personality. Her framework uses personality assessments for both parents and children, then maps the dynamic between them. Where connection flows easily. Where the prickly spots are.
